CHARLOTTE, N.C. -- A heavy line of thunderstorms pounded much of the metro Charlotte area and surrounding cities Friday, causing cancellations to several high school football games, thousands of power outages, and minor damage.

About 8,000 Mecklenburg County residents were without power as of 11 p.m. Friday.  About 3,200 are without power in Lincoln County, and about 2,100 are in the dark in Cabarrus County.

All Charlotte-Mecklenburg Schools football games were postponed and will be made up Tuesday night starting at 7 p.m.  The games will not be played on Monday because of Labor Day.

Rock Hill High School will resume its matchup at Nation Ford at 7:30 p.m. Saturday.  Charlotte Catholic High School and Charlotte Country Day will resume play Saturday morning at 11.  Crest and Shelby will hit the turf against Saturday at 7:30 p.m.
